Jane has 6/7 of a yard of ribbon she uses 3/4 of a yard to trim an ornament how much ribbon is left

Answer:

= 3/28

Step-by-step explanation:

yard of ribbon Jane has= 6/7

yard of ribbon she used to trim an ornament = 3/4

ribbion left = 6/7 - 3/4

                     LCM= 28

                  = 24/28 - 21/28

                 = 3/28
